In contrast, extrinsic motivation is influenced by external factors such as social recognition, financial incentives, or legal obligations. Although it can provoke immediate action and provide short-term reinforcement, it may not support the deep-rooted changes necessary for sustained recovery. For example, someone might choose to seek treatment due to family pressure or concerns about legal consequences, but such motivations may fade once the pressing issues are resolved. Establishing a daily routine is vital for maintaining motivation during recovery. A structured itinerary promotes stability, grounding individuals when faced with uncertainty. By planning out daily activities, you minimize the risks of boredom and overwhelm, which can lead to setbacks.
